Description

Domestic ground rice screening installation
Technical Field
The utility model relates to a screening installation especially relates to a domestic ground rice screening installation.
Background
In daily life, rice flour is needed to be used for some time, but the rice flour is thick or thin, the rice flour needs to be screened, and then subsequent use is carried out.
Therefore, it is necessary to design and develop a household rice flour screening apparatus which can replace manual work to screen rice flour, is labor-saving, and can perform multi-stage screening on rice flour.
SUMMERY OF THE UTILITY MODEL
In order to overcome the needs and pour the rice flour into the sieve, the continuous sieve that rocks again screens the rice flour, and time is long, and is more hard, and can only carry out the shortcoming of once screening to the rice flour, the technical problem that solve is: the household rice flour screening equipment can replace manual work to screen rice flour, is labor-saving, and can screen the rice flour in a multi-stage mode.
The technical scheme of the utility model is that: a household rice flour screening device comprises a fixing block, a supporting column, a frame body, a first handle, sliding blocks, a screening frame, a supporting block, a motor, a loading frame, a cover plate, a rotating shaft, a roller, a stirring rod, a filtering frame, sliding rails, sliding blocks, a collecting frame and a second handle.
Preferably, the mesh of the screening frame has a density smaller than that of the filtering frame, so that fine rice flour can be screened.
Preferably, the mesh of the collection frame is less dense than the mesh of the screening frame, enabling the screening of finer rice flour.
Preferably, the cover plate is provided with a sealing strip at the contact position with the loading frame, so that the rice flour can be prevented from floating out of the loading frame.
Preferably, the material of puddler is stainless steel material, avoids causing the pollution to the ground rice.
Preferably, the frame body both sides are opened there is a word hole and sliding block cooperation, makes things convenient for the sliding block can wider back-and-forth movement.

2. A household rice flour screening apparatus as claimed in claim 1, wherein said screen frame (6) has a mesh density less than that of the filter frame (14) to screen out fine rice flour.
3. A household rice flour screening apparatus as claimed in claim 2, wherein said collection frame (17) has a mesh density less than that of the screening frame (6) to screen finer rice flour.
4. A household rice flour screening apparatus as claimed in claim 3, wherein the contact position of said cover plate (10) with the loading frame (9) is provided with a sealing strip to prevent rice flour from floating out of the loading frame (9).
5. A household rice flour screening apparatus as claimed in claim 4, wherein the stirring rod (13) is made of stainless steel material to avoid pollution to rice flour.
6. A household rice flour screening apparatus as claimed in claim 5, wherein said frame (3) is provided with a slotted hole on both sides for engaging with the sliding block (5) to facilitate the sliding block (5) to move forward and backward in a wider range.
